Here at Avenues Aspley, we share a vision of empowering the Educators within our centre to work together on the journey of reconciliation. We acknowledge the importance of having a Reconciliation Action Plan in place and working together as a team to increase our knowledge and improve our relationships with the First Nations peoples within our community. As we continue to work towards the ongoing goals we have set, we continue to teach and share our journey about reconciliation with the younger generations within our care. This impacts the way children think and act, ensuring the future is inclusive, and everyone has equal and equitable opportunities. We continue to provide an educational environment where all members of our community feel safe and supported within our service as we build our understanding of the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ples’ histories and cultures. We are supporting our Early Learning Centre to consistently work towards growth and cultural responsiveness, which will allow our organistaion to practice reconciliation through our policies, procedures and actions. Connecting with local Elders and community continues to help us understand and celebrate the uniqueness and diversity of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ples both locally and across Australia.
